There are two basic types of divorce law: fault and not fault. The states that use a no fault system do not make it a requirement that there be a conspicuous reason for the divorce. It is often enough to assert that the couple has irreconcilable differences.

Other states use a more traditional "fault" system where the spouse wanting the divorce must show a reason why the divorce should be legalized. This often means showing adultery or abuse.
